Rooms are small but very clean and well maintained. Our only wish was that the room and balcony had been bigger. The pool was great and many families took advantage of it. The menu is varied for European tastes but has a very good Greek variety. (I loved the baked Spaghetti) Since breakfast isn't a big meal out we ate the buffet and it was good. The beach and extra dinning area are across the street as are all the hotels and restaurants in that vicinity. The AC in our room was great as was the water pressure. Soap, bath gel provided, however, as in may European hotels there are no wash cloths so be warned to pack something if this is important to you.

The Aphrodite hotel has a very good restaurant, a helpful staff, and is just across a road that separates it from the best beach on the Greek island of Lesvos. The hotel provides tables, showers, lawn chairs and beach umbrellas on the beach. My wife and I were there in mid-September when it was fairly quiet and we had Vatera beach pretty much to ourselves. You need a car to drive to Vatera from the airport and to go to some of the other beaches and villages scattered throughout the large island of Lesvos. In mid-September the weather was great and we enjoyed ourselves at the Aphrodite hotel.
